For all of those wondering, the US release date of Three's Co. is 29
August 2006 on Rough Trade
America. The album will feature two bonus remix tracks, one by James
Figurine (aka Jimmy Tamborella, Dntel, Postal Service) and one by Nobody
(Elvin of Mystic Chords of Memory).

Click to watch our new music video for
"Brock Landers" from our forthcoming album, Three's Co.,
out on April 17th on Rough Trade Records. The video, directed by S. Tobin Kirk
for DOA Films, was shot on
16mm at San Onofre & Cardiff Beaches in Southern California.

The Tyde have contributed a track, "Pound for Pound", on Still
Unravished, a tribute to indie-pop's finest, The
June Brides, released on yesboyicecream
records.

++HAPPY NEW YEAR!!! Our new record, "Three's Co." comes out in the UK on March 13th. It's our third long player, recorded in Los Angeles in early 2004. It features special guests Conor Deasy (The Thrills) and Mickey Madden (Maroon 5) on vocals and bass, respectively. Look out for a 12" vinyl single featuring remixes from James Figurine (DNTEL) and DJ Nobody.++
Tracklist:
1. Do It Again Again
2. Brock Landers
3. Separate Cars
4. Too Many Kims
5. Glassbottom Lights
6. The Lamest Shows
7. Ltd. Appeal
8. County Line
9. Aloha Breeze
10. The Pilot
11. Don't Need a Leash
